The short answer

Working Student & Internship jobs in Germany center on Excel (16% of postings), with demand spread across business methods, industrial & electrical, business tools. Roles concentrate in Berlin; about 32% are hybrid. Across 1604 postings, Kariyan Job-Index, Germany.

What the data changes about how you apply

Reads that should change a decision

No single skill rules this role

The dataThe top skill (Excel) is only 16% of postings; demand spreads across Excel, Teamwork, Consulting.Do thisPosition around a profile, not one tool. Show the recurring combination, not a single keyword.

This role is less remote than it feels

The dataOnly 4% of postings are fully remote. Hybrid is 32% and onsite 43%.Do thisPlan your search around being reachable from a hub; treat fully-remote roles as a bonus, not the baseline.

Do these roles need German?

German is expected in this field: 79% of the roles that state a policy require it.

German optional 10%
German a plus 2%
German required 43%
Not stated 45%

0% are advertised in English. 729 postings state no language requirement, so silence is not a yes to German. Based on each posting's stated language policy; directional.
